Technical Considerations and Cautionary Notes

While the Family Christmas SVG is robust, it is not without its constraints. Crafters must use caution when applying it to very small surfaces. Thin lines, while elegant, can become fragile when cut from adhesive vinyl at smaller scales. If you are making mini ornaments or tiny planner stickers, consider simplifying the layout or removing the finest details to prevent tearing during weeding.

Color contrast is another critical factor. When using the PNG design for sublimation on dark fabrics, remember that standard sublimation ink does not print white. You will need to use a white underbase or choose light-colored blanks to ensure the design pops. I tested it on a black t-shirt using white HTV for the text elements, and it looked fantastic, but attempting to sublimate the full-color version directly onto dark fabric would result in a muddy, unreadable mess.

Layered vinyl projects require precise alignment. If you plan to create multi-color versions of the Christmas Squad Svg or Christmas Crew Svg variations, take your time with registration marks. Misalignment can ruin the professional look of the final product. Always do a test cut on scrap material before committing to your final inventory.

For those interested in print-on-demand services, ensure you check the resolution of the accompanying PNG files. While SVGs are vector-based and infinitely scalable, PNGs have fixed dimensions. Confirm that the resolution is at least 300 DPI at your intended print size to avoid pixelation. This step is vital for maintaining the quality expected in a creative marketplace.

Licensing and Business Ethics

Before integrating any design assets into your commercial workflow, always review the license terms. Most reputable designers provide a commercial license for handmade sellers, but restrictions may apply to mass production or digital resale. Ensure you understand the boundaries of your usage rights. Using the Family Christmas SVG for physical products like shirts, mugs, and tote bags is typically permitted, but reselling the digital file itself is usually prohibited. Respecting these terms protects your handmade business and supports the original creator.
